What Is a Flex Deck?

A flex deck is a specialized type of skateboard or similar sporting board that incorporates flexible materials into its construction. Unlike traditional decks that prioritize rigidity for stability, flex decks are designed with an emphasis on bending, allowing for dynamic movements, improved shock absorption, and enhanced control. They are typically constructed with composite materials such as fiberglass, carbon fiber, or specialized plastics integrated into the deck's core.

Types of Flex Decks: Materials and Design Innovations

Advancements in materials science have led to various types of flex decks, each suited to different rider needs and preferences. The key types include:

Fiberglass Flex Decks

Utilize layers of fiberglass woven into the deck core, offering excellent flexibility combined with high strength. Ideal for riders seeking dynamic response and durability.

Carbon Fiber Flex Decks

Incorporate carbon fiber layers for maximum lightweight strength and stiffness, allowing for precise control and rapid response. Popular among professional skaters and downhill enthusiasts.

Composite Plastic Flex Decks

Made from high-quality plastics like polycarbonate or ABS, these decks are highly flexible, impact-resistant, and affordable. Suitable for casual riders and entry-level skate shops.

Hybrid Flex Decks

Combine different materials like fiberglass and carbon fiber to optimize flexibility, strength, and weight. They often feature adjustable flex zones for personalized performance.

Design Considerations for Flex Decks

When selecting a flex deck, several design elements influence performance:

  • Material Thickness: Thicker layers generally provide more strength but less flex, while thinner layers increase flexibility.
  • Flex Zones: Specific areas of the deck designed to bend more, aiding in tricks and carving.
  • Shape and Profile: Concave profiles, nose/tail shapes, and width impact flexibility and control.
  • Construction Method: Techniques like layering, lamination, and curing affect overall durability and flexibility.

Choosing the Right Flex Deck for Your Needs

When selecting a flex deck, consider the following factors:

  • Riding Style: Downhill riders often prefer stiffer flex for stability, whereas freestyle skaters might opt for more bendability for tricks.
  • Skill Level: Beginners benefit from moderate flex for easier rideability, while advanced skaters can push toward higher flex levels.
  • Weight and Size: Match deck dimensions with your body size and weight to optimize ride comfort and control.
  • Material Preferences and Budget: Balancing cost and performance ensures the best value for your investment.
